Holding
The Respondents' bill of costs is taxed at Kshs.52,100/-
Facts
The landlord sought assessment of costs pertaining to a reference dated 13th May 2021, which was marked as withdrawn with costs to the Respondents. The amount in arrears was Kshs.372,030/- as at 31st January 2021.
Issues
- Assessment of costs
- Taxation of costs
Reasoning
The court allowed items 1, 5, 6, 7, 8, 10, and 11 of the bill of costs as prayed. Items 2 and 3 were taxed off as they were already catered for under item 1. Items 3 and 4 were taxed off as no hearing took place on both days. A sum of Kshs.700/- was taxed off from item 12. Items 13 and 14 were allowed as prayed. Item 15 was assessed at Kshs.1400/- and taxed off Kshs.700/-.
Outcome
The Respondents' bill of costs is taxed at Kshs.52,100/-
